Ronaldo has struggled for game time under Ten Hag.
Despite recent troubles which has seen him forced to train with Manchester United’s reserve team, Cristiano Ronaldo via an Instagram post, has assured fans of the English side of his “commitment and dedication.’’
The Portuguese national team captain held talks with coach Erik Ten Hag after he was omitted from the United side that played a 1-1 draw against Chelsea over the weekend due to his bad conduct in a league game against Tottenham Hotspur on Wednesday, October 19, 2022.
Ronaldo left the pitch for the dressing room before full time to show his anger over Ten Hag’s decision to leave him on the bench. The Dutch coach later revealed that he wanted to bring the former Real Madrid star late into the game, but he declined and left for the dressing room instead.
However, Ronaldo has resolved issues with Ten Hag and is expected to feature in Manchester United’s Europea League clash against Sheriff on Thursday night, October 27, 2022.
